#590466 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#590466 is composed of 34.9% red, 1.6% green and 40%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 12.7% cyan, 96.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 60% black. It has a hue angle of 292 degrees, a saturation of 92.5% and a lightness of 20.8%. #590466 color hex could be obtained by blending #b208cc with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

Shades and Tints of #590466
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070008 is the darkest color, while #fdf4ff is the lightest one.
